Output ec120ce016e32a4b780d49f309e31d9fa56b68aaad16ee1e62880a6391d7da59:5

value
56515
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 447e23f8594febccae2d8fb562632d3fdd9eb68c018b247ecc970232abf0c191
address
bc1pg3lz87zefl4uet3d376kyced8lwead5vqx9jglkvjupr92lscxgsrcjpvy
transaction
ec120ce016e32a4b780d49f309e31d9fa56b68aaad16ee1e62880a6391d7da59
confirmations
76430
spent
true